* If you would like a different therapist to supervise a note, form, or report who is not the primary therapist, you can do so by following these steps:
Note 1. Click "New Note" 2. Select client name 3. Select therapist from the "Supervising Therapist" drop down menu 4. Click "Yes" Form 1. Click "Start a Form" 2. Select client name 3. Select template from the "Form Template" drop down menu 4. Select therapist from the "Supervising Therapist" drop down menu 5. Click "Yes" Report 1. Click "Generate a Report" 2. Select client name 3. Select your star/end dates and requested continued treatment if applicable 4. Select template from the "Report Template" drop down menu 5. Select therapist from the "Supervising Therapist" drop down menu 6. Click "Yes" Important things to note: The supervising therapist you select will be the official signer for that specific note, form, or report Their name will appear in the client list under "Supervisor" for that specific note, form, or report The primary therapist remains the same for that client Any therapist can be selected as the supervising therapist as long as they are a supervisor and have access to the client To learn how to change the primary therapist for a client, click here.
